6-2 International Residential Code

A.    Adoption

The International Residential Code, 2009 edition, including Appendix Chapters E, J, L, and O, as published by the International Code Council is hereby adopted by reference as the Residential Code of the City of Ouray, State of Colorado, for regulating and governing the construction, alteration, movement, enlargement, replacement, repair, equipment, location, removal and demolition of detached one- and two-family dwellings and multiple single-family dwellings (townhouses) not more than three stories in height with separate means of egress as herein provided; providing for the issuance of permit and collection of fees therefor; with the additions, insertions, deletions and changes, as described in this Chapter.

B.    Copy on File

A copy of the International Residential Code, 2009 edition, is on file at the office of the City of Ouray Building Inspector.

C.    Amendments

The International Residential Code, 2009 edition, is amended to read as follows:

1.    Section R101.1 Title is amended as follows:

These provisions shall be known as Residential Code for One- and Two-family Dwellings of the City of Ouray.

2.    Section 105.2. Work exempt from permit. Building, Subsection 1 is amended as follows:

One-story detached accessory structures used as tool and storage sheds, playhouses and similar uses, provided the floor area does not exceed 120 square feet.

3.    Section 108.5 Refunds is amended as follows:

Refunds shall be provided for in compliance with the refund policy of the City’s adopted building code.

4.    Section R109.1.5 Other inspections is amended by the addition of subsection R109.1.5.2 as follows:

R109.1.5.2. Insulation. Insulation is required to meet the standards of the International Energy Conservation Code, 2009 Edition.

5.    Section 112.1 General is amended as follows:

In order to hear and decide appeals of orders, decisions, or determinations made by the building official relative to the application and interpretation of this code, there shall be and is hereby created a board of appeals. The building official shall be an exofficio member of said board but shall have no vote on any matter before the board. The board of appeals shall consist of the members of City Council of the City of Ouray. The board may adopt rules of procedure for conducting its business, and shall render all decision and findings in writing to the appellant with a duplicate copy to the building official.

6.    Section 112.3 Qualifications is deleted in its entirety, along with all references thereto.

8.    Section 313.1 Townhouse automatic fire sprinkler systems is amended as follows:

Effective January 1, 2013, an automatic residential fire sprinkler system shall be installed in all two-family dwellings. As of January 1, 2012, automatic residential fire sprinkler systems may be required in any type of residence that, in the discretion of the building inspector, are located in such an area as to be difficult for emergency access by the Fire Department.

9.    Section 319.1 Address numbers is amended as follows:

Buildings shall have approved address numbers, building numbers or approved building identification placed in a position that is plainly legible and visible from the street or road fronting the property. These numbers shall contrast with their background. Address numbers shall be Arabic numbers or alphabetical letters. For new construction only, numbers shall be a minimum of 4 inches (102 mm) high with a minimum stroke width of 1/2 inch (12.7 mm). Where access is by means of a private road and the building address cannot be viewed from the public way, a monument, pole or other sign or means shall be used to identify the structure.

10.    Section G2406.2 Prohibited locations is amended by the deletion of subsections 3 and 4.

11.    Section G2425.8 Appliances not required to be vented is amended by the deletion of subsection 7, along with all references thereto.

12.    Section G2445.1 General is amended as follows:

Unvented room heaters are prohibited in all locations and throughout all occupancies.

13.    Section P2603.6.1 Sewer depth is amended as follows:

Private sewage disposal systems are not permitted within the City of Ouray.

D.    Penalty

The following penalty clause as contained in the International Residential Code, 2009 Edition, is hereby set forth in full and adopted:

Section R113.4 Violation Penalties. Any person who violates a provision of this code or fails to comply with any of the requirements thereof or who erects, constructs, alters or repairs a building or structure in violation of the approved construction document or directive of the building official or of a permit or certificate issued under the provision of this code, shall be subject to penalties as prescribed by law.
